"F# code can even be compiled in an OCaml compiler, often without modification."
I think you have that backwards. The #light syntax preferred by F# is not compatible with ocaml. ocaml and the non light syntax are about the same though.

"F# also has a feature called ‘computation expressions,’ and we’re particularly happy with the unity we’ve achieved here. "
Computation Expressions aka Monads
"The designers of F# use term "computation expression" and "workflow" because its less obscure and daunting than the word "monad." [1]
